Claims (10)
- バイタルサインモニタリングのためのモニタリング装置に備え付けられる医療センサであって、
基板と、前記基板の対向する側の1つに設けられる電極パターンとを備えるフレキシブル回路層と、
前記フレキシブル回路層に積層される発泡層であって、前記発泡層に対向する前記電極パターンと位置合わせして開口部を形成する発泡層と、
前記フレキシブル回路層と前記発泡層との間に挟まれて、前記発泡層を前記フレキシブル回路層に接合する接着層であって、前記接着層は、前記発泡層の前記開口部と位置合わせして開口部を形成し、前記接着層の面積は、前記発泡層の面積よりも小さく、前記発泡層の周囲に隣接する部分は、前記接着層によって覆われず、前記接着層によって前記フレキシブル回路層に接合されない、接着層と、
前記発泡層及び前記電極パターンの前記開口部を介して、前記電極パターンに配設されて、前記電極パターンに電気的に接続されることができるゲルスポンジと、
を備えることを特徴とする医療センサ。 - 前記発泡層の前記周囲は、前記フレキシブル回路層の周囲内にあることを特徴とする、請求項1に記載の医療センサ。
- 前記ゲルスポンジの厚さは、前記発泡層及び前記接着層の合計の厚さよりもわずかに大きいことを特徴とする、請求項1に記載の医療センサ。
- 前記電極パターンは、導電性インクで、前記基板上に印刷されることを特徴とする、請求項1に記載の医療センサ。
- 前記導電性インクは、熱可塑性導電性インクであることを特徴とする、請求項4に記載の医療センサ。
- 更に、前記発泡層の前記フレキシブル回路層と反対の側に接着される剥離ライナを備えることを特徴とする、請求項1に記載の医療センサ。
- 更に、前記フレキシブル回路層の前記基板の前記発泡層と反対の側に、前記電極パターンと位置合わせして配設される補強材を備え、前記補強材は、前記電極パターンの形状を保つのに十分な硬さであることを特徴とする、請求項1に記載の医療センサ。
- 前記補強材は、大きさ及び形状が前記電極パターンと実質的に同じであることを特徴とする、請求項7に記載の医療センサ。
- 前記基板は、実質的に円形の本体部と、前記本体部の周囲から延在して、ユーザが前記医療センサを扱いやすくするタブとを備えることを特徴とする、請求項1に記載の医療センサ。
- 前記フレキシブル回路層は、更に、前記基板上に設けられる複数のトレースを備え、前記基板は、実質的に円形の本体部と、前記本体部の周囲から延在する尾部とを備え、前記電極パターンは、前記本体部に設けられ、前記複数の導電トレースは、前記尾部に設けられ、前記尾部に沿って延在し、前記複数の導電トレースの両端は、それぞれ、前記電極パターン及び前記モニタリング装置に電気的に接続されることを特徴とする、請求項1に記載の医療センサ。
